Abstract

Microgrid connects the distributed power supply with the assistance of power electronic devices. Power electronic devices, especially in the inversion link, play a crucial role in the access of distributed power to microgrid. Whether in grid-connected mode or island mode, the control method of inverters is related to the stable operation of distributed power supply and plays an important role in the control strategy of microgrid. In this paper, by adding the drop control of controllable virtual impedance, the power coupling problem caused by resistive line impedance is reduced, and virtual impedance key points such as voltage feedback and frequency compensation are added. By optimizing the power reference value, the parallel operation stability of the control strategy is improved. The experimental results show that the proposed method improves not only the stability of the system and the power quality but also the accuracy of reactive power distribution.
